Peruvian mayor arrested over Xstrata protest


The mayor of  a Peruvian town has been arrested for inciting protests outside a mine owned by Swiss firm Xstrata.

Police arrested Oscar Mollohuanca of the Espinar province, after two protesters died, and dozens of people were injured in clashes this week.

Protesters claim a copper mine owned by Xstrata is polluting two rivers, though the Zug-based company denies that.

On Monday, Peru declared a 30-day state of emergency in the province.
